Output 8d3e7dbc3db32e063be6c5ecf6a76b3d09655eb3e7adf384d2acff2bb2a64678:45

value
543697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db4f3e49852692cc6c591057403b96eea136811 OP_EQUAL
address
3Jz6QcaPX9WotVPhE6F6sn5FDL6Hd5GZqn
transaction
8d3e7dbc3db32e063be6c5ecf6a76b3d09655eb3e7adf384d2acff2bb2a64678